## Deployment

The Lumacache image service has a known slow leak in its thumbnail cache layer: evicted entries keep a reference alive through the decoder pool, so resident memory creeps up roughly 40 MB per hour under steady load. Until the refactor in the Harkness branch lands, we mitigate by capping pool size and scheduling a rolling restart every 12 hours. Deploy with the supervisor, never bare, or the restart hook won't fire. The deployment relies on the configuration values listed below.

settings of bagug-tahof:
holath:
  pin: 7837
  metrics_host: metrics.holath.tolvaqsys.internal
  tenant: quenath
  seal: seal_6001b3af

# Break-Glass: Catalog Cache Invalidation

Scope: the Pinrow product catalog at Veldstone Retail. If stale prices persist after a purge and the Hollowmere invalidation queue is wedged, use break-glass to flush the edge tier directly. Contractors: get verbal sign-off from the catalog lead first. Steps: open the Hollowmere admin shell, select emergency-flush, confirm the tenant, and run it once — repeated flushes thrash the origin. Access is logged and expires after 20 minutes. Unseal the admin shell with the passphrase below.

recovery phrase for kahop-tajog: istix-casvan

### Release Checklist — Item 7: BranchBroom stale-branch cleanup bot

For the security reviewer: confirm that BranchBroom 1.6 operates with a scoped automation credential limited to branch deletion and comment posting, nothing broader. Verify the dry-run audit log matches the actual deletion list, that protected-branch patterns from the Ostermark config are honored, and that deleted refs are archived for thirty days before purge. No credential material is baked into the image. The reviewed artifact corresponds to the build token recorded below.

trace token, fafog-kageg: htk4_98e6

### ☐ Verify circuit breaker on the Pondwick upstream API

Before shipping, flip the breaker manually in staging and confirm Marlette falls back to cached rates within 5 seconds. We got burned last quarter when the breaker tripped but never reset — half-open probes were pointed at the wrong health endpoint. Double-check the probe path is `/healthz/live`, not `/healthz`. Also confirm the dashboard panel actually shows breaker state; Teodora fixed the metric name but the panel may be stale. Record the staging build token from this run right here.

session token of taduf-tahog = htk4_91a1